Progress


Underpainting continues. Typically, images are underpainted in contrasting colors such as oranges, reds, or greens depending on the final color. These colors are then painted over with opaque colors. The trompe l'oeil panels at the bottom of each quadrant are painted using a direct technique.

Panels Arrive

The mural is being painted on fiberglass reinforced concrete panels. The panels arrived in May 2010 and were placed in a warehouse on the campus of the University of South Alabama. Each quadrant is made of two panels which are joined together along a central seam. The mural will be painted, the panels separated, installed in the bell tower, and I will touch-up the seam on site. Because of the substrate and the exterior location, I am using Keim mineral paint. It's longevity is estimated at 80 - 100 years with direct exposure.
